Handover from Mira to Tolvan re: the LiftPath elevator-dispatch simulator. All scenario seeds are checked in, the dispatch heuristics are documented in the design folder, and the replay harness passes cleanly. For the security review, the encrypted results archive needs unlocking; the recovery passphrase is the line that follows.

vault phrase of hahop-badug = novvan-ulaion-zorius-noviel-gorwyn-casix-tamys

## Escalation — Schemavault

If schema registration fails during a release, halt the deploy. Check Schemavault health endpoint; a 503 means the registry quorum is degraded. Do not force-publish schemas. Roll back producers first, consumers second. Quorum recovery is owned by the Eventworks platform team. Page them via the address below.

escalation mailbox, hadug-bajog: sormir@norvalabs.internal

Welcome, future maintainers. The Bramblegate partner SFTP drop receives nightly CSVs from our vendors, and the Thistledown poller sweeps them into the ingest queue. Most hiccups are just stuck lock files — clear them and rerun. To poke the Thistledown admin endpoint while debugging, use the internal key below.

app token of bahaf-tajeg = zpat23_SjjsllwiLmXbtS65veZaV47

## Further Reading

The cron drift investigation on the Tallyhook scheduler wrapped up last quarter, but support tickets about skewed job times still come in. Root cause was NTP stepping on the Verdane worker pool combined with a stale timezone bundle. Symptoms, detection queries, and the remediation timeline are all documented. The full write-up lives on our internal wiki.

operations page: https://confluence.tolvaqsys.corp/spaces/pages/pages/6e787158f507

The tier bundles priority support, the Glassmere analytics suite, and quarterly strategy reviews, priced roughly 40% above the standard plan. Pilot feedback from twelve accounts indicates strong uptake intent among mid-market customers, though churn risk exists among price-sensitive users at the lower boundary. Heads of department should prepare staffing and support-capacity estimates before the launch gate review. The commercial rationale and launch timing are set out in the confidential note below.

internal memo for bahap-yagug: Headcount on the Ulaix team goes from 3 to 100 by the end of January. Gross margin on Ulaix came in at 10 percent against a plan of 15 percent.